Apparently the six percent real estate commission – 3 percent to both buyer’s and seller’s agents – was never “set in stone,” but alot of people did think that due to the business practices of trade organization. It led to a class action lawsuit – and a major upheaval in the Real estate business. More from WFIR’s Gene Marrano:

The Salem-Roanoke County Chamber of Commerce is growing, membership-wise and cutting the ribbon at new business openings on a regular basis. So says executive director Amanda Livingston – who also said live in-studio on WFIR this morning that a “re-fresh” of the Chamber office at Longwood Park in Salem now includes co-lab space for members. The Salem-Roanoke Chamber will also recognize local businesses at its awards breakfast next Friday. Atlantic Union and American National Bank have received regulatory approval for the merger. The banks announced the merger agreement in July 2023. WFIR’s Denise Allen Membreno tells us what customers should expect.

Virginians appear to be looking at a glass half-full economy these days, feeling better about the overall picture – and where the Commonwealth is headed. That’s a takeaway from the latest Roanoke College quarterly survey. More from WFIR’s Gene Marrano:
